Secret Features to Consider When Choosing a robot vacuum best Vacuum Cleaner in the UK

Picking the ideal robot vacuum for your UK home needs cautious consideration of a number of functions. Here's a breakdown of the vital aspects to assess:

  • Suction Power: This is critical for efficient cleaning. Higher suction power usually equates to much better performance, particularly on carpets and for selecting up pet hair. Consider the types of floor covering in your house. Houses with mainly tough floorings might be adequate with less powerful designs, while homes with thick carpets require more powerful suction.
  • Navigation and Mapping: Robot vacuums browse using various innovations.
    • Fundamental Random Navigation: These models move arbitrarily around the room, altering direction when they encounter obstacles. They are less effective and may miss spots.
    • Systematic Navigation: Employing gyroscopes or accelerometers, these robotics tidy in straight lines and are more effective and cover the whole location more methodically.
    • Smart Mapping (LiDAR or Camera-Based): Advanced models utilize L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or electronic cameras to develop detailed maps of your home. This permits:
      • Room-by-room cleaning: You can direct the robot to specific spaces.
      • No-go zones: Define locations you want the robot to prevent, such as fragile furnishings or pet feeding bowls.
      • Customizable cleaning schedules for various spaces.
      • Real-time tracking and tracking through a smartphone app.
  • Battery Life and Coverage: Consider the size of your home. A larger home will require a robot vacuum with a longer battery life to guarantee it can clean the whole space on a single charge. Look for battery life requirements and the area protection per charge.
  • Brush System: Different brush systems are designed for different floor types. Search for robotics with:
    • Main Brushroll: Typically a combination of bristles and rubber blades to efficiently upset and raise dirt from carpets and hard floorings.
    • Side Brushes: Extend beyond the robot's body to sweep particles from edges and corners into the path of the primary brushroll.
    • Tangle-Free Brushrolls: Ideal for pet owners, these styles decrease hair entanglement and make maintenance much easier.
  • Dustbin Capacity and Self-Emptying: Dustbin capability identifies how typically you need to clear the robot. Bigger capabilities are more effective for bigger homes or homes with pets. Self-emptying designs automatically transfer collected particles into a larger dustbin in the charging base, substantially minimizing manual clearing frequency.
  • Mopping Function: Some robot vacuums provide a mopping function, typically using a wet cloth or vibrating mop pad. These are typically appropriate for light mopping and keeping difficult floorings, however not for heavy-duty stain elimination. Consider if a combination vacuum-mop appropriates for your needs.
  • App Control and Smart Features: Many robot vacuums are managed via mobile phone apps, providing functions like:
    • Scheduling cleaning sessions.
    • Beginning and stopping cleaning from another location.
    • Monitoring cleaning development and battery life.
    • Accessing maps, setting no-go zones, and personalizing cleaning modes.
    • Voice control combination.
  • Sound Level: Robot vacuums do create noise. Think about noise levels, especially if you prepare to run the vacuum while you are home or delicate to sound. Lower decibel rankings suggest quieter operation.
  • Pet Hair Handling: For pet owners in the UK, pet hair handling is a crucial element. Look for robot vacuums specifically developed to take on pet hair, often featuring stronger suction, tangle-free brushrolls, and effective purification systems.
  • Rate and Budget: Robot vacuum vary in rate from budget-friendly designs to high-end premium devices. Establish your spending plan and weigh the features and benefits against the expense to discover the very best value for your needs.

Maintaining Your Robot Vacuum Cleaner

To ensure your robot vacuum continues to carry out optimally and enjoys a long life-span, regular maintenance is essential. This typically involves:

  • Emptying the dustbin regularly: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ning cycle or as needed, depending on the model and dust build-up.
  • Cleaning the brushes: Remove hair and debris tangled around the primary brushroll and side brushes.
  • Replacing filters: Replace filters periodically as suggested by the maker to maintain suction and air purification.
  • Cleaning sensors: Wipe sensors clean with a soft fabric to guarantee proper navigation.
  • Checking for obstructions: Inspect the robot for any clogs in the suction path.

Q: Do robot vacuum work in multi-story UK homes with stairs?

A: Most robot vacuum cleaners are not created to climb stairs. If you have a multi-story home, you will require to manually move the robot to each floor or think about purchasing a robot for each level. Some higher-end designs may have cliff sensors to avoid them from falling down stairs, however they still can not navigate between floorings autonomously.
